ت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
[VB.NET] كيف اجعل listbox تستوعب اكبر عدد ممكن من الكلمات او الارقام
#1
سلام عليكم
قدد واجهت صعوبة في جمع واضافة اعدد كبيرة في
ضمن برنامج خاص بتوزيع الطعام
ولكن المشكلة في
عدم استعياب listbox اكبر عدد من الاسماء عند
1000 شخص وباقي يحذف
مالحل؟
الرد }}}
تم الشكر بواسطة:
#2
?????????????????????????????????/
الرد }}}
تم الشكر بواسطة:
#3
الكود كامل

PHP كود :
  Dim t As System.Threading.Thread
    
Private Sub OpenIdFileTextToolStripMenuItem_Click(ByVal sender As System.ObjectByVal e As System.EventArgsHandles OpenIdFileTextToolStripMenuItem.Click
        CheckForIllegalCrossThreadCalls 
False
        ServicePointManager
.DefaultConnectionLimit Integer.MaxValue
        t 
= New Thread(AddressOf ob_en)
        t.IsBackground True
        t
.SetApartmentState(ApartmentState.STA)
        t.Start()
    End Sub

    
Public Sub ob_en()
        Dim s As New OpenFileDialog
        s
.Filter "text | *.txt"
        s.Title "import Combolist"
        s.ShowDialog()
        Dim allLines() As String System.IO.File.ReadAllLines(s.FileName)
        ListBox1.Items.AddRange(allLines)
    End Sub 
الرد }}}
تم الشكر بواسطة: aleeee , aleeee
#4
مستحيل هل تقصد ان الاداة لا تقبل الا ألف أسم فقط .
لا يمكن هذا اتصور ان المشكلة في برمجتك
الرد }}}
تم الشكر بواسطة:



الت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م